How much do programming team man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for programming team manager in the United States is $70,857.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,000.00 and $88,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Role description: Arcadis is seeking a BIM Team Manager to join our team within the North America Places Group. We're seeking an experienced leader with technical expertise to lead at Arcadis and in the industry.

This position is hybrid and can be based anywhere in the United States of America. As the BIM Team Manager, you will support the Design and Engineering team in the Places Division during the development of high-profile projects from design to construction, as applicable to the client's needs, as part of our BIM Management Service offerings. You will be involved in standards, automation, and model-driven delivery across all design and engineering disciplines to improve quality, reduce cycle time, and deliver measurable business value.

Role accountabilities: Define where applicable project standards and implement BIM standards, BEP templates, naming conventions, QA/QC checks, and CDE folder structures tailored to project types and client requirements Lead ACC administration in the BIM environment: folder structures, permissions, workflows, and integration with project management systems Establish model coordination processes across projects: scheduled clash detection, issue triage, model health scoring, and remediation Build an automation roadmap focused on delivery needs: prioritize Dynamo and API scripts that reduce repetitive modelling, QC and quantification tasks Oversee model lifecycle integration for 3D/4D/5D and contractor model submittals on projects, support progress reporting and cost integration Recruit, develop, and manage BIM staff; create role-based training and certification to achieve baseline competency across US teams Provide input to project estimates for BIM scope and resource schedule; monitor utilization and recovery across projects Report monthly on BIM KPIs and deliverable status to the Design Management Practice Lead Qualifications & Experience: 15+ years in BIM environments; 5+ years leading multidisciplinary BIM teams and establishing standards, preferably within the US market or on US projects Deep experience with ACC/BIM 360, Revit, Navisworks, Civil 3D; working knowledge of Bentley desirable Demonstrated capability in automation (Dynamo, Revit API, scripting) and delivering quantifiable process improvements Strong stakeholder management, communication, and training capability; experience with BEP authoring, QA frameworks, and model lifecycle management Bachelor's degree in Engineering, CAD, Information Management or equivalent experience Role accountabilities: Qualifications & Experience: Continue your career journey as an Arcadian.
